Seven matches of Dzyuba without goals

The match against Rubin was one of the most unsuccessful matches for Artyom Dziuba in the current season.

He looked like a pale shadow of himself and hardly clung to the ball.

As a result, the Zenit captain was actually cut off from the team, which, among other things, predetermined the first home defeat of Petersburgers in the RPL in almost two years - 1: 2.

The statistics are also very eloquent.

In 90 minutes, the striker defeated 197-centimeter Silvie Begic and 187-centimeter Karl Starfelt in just one single combat and did not shoot at someone else's goal, which has happened to him three times this season.

In the matches against Lokomotiv (0: 0) and Dynamo (0: 1) Artyom also did not threaten other people's goals, and Zenit did not score a single goal in the end.

The wards of Sergei Semak managed to upset Rubin after playing the standard position, and the forward played the role of a football player in it, drawing the attention of the opponent's defense.

The meeting with Kazan became for Dziuba the seventh in a row without goals.

The footballer did not score in four matches for Zenit and three for the national team.

The striker scored the last ball at his own expense at the end of September in the game with the Premier League outsider Ufa, in which he scored a hat-trick.

But the beginning of the season turned out to be quite successful for Dziuba.

He upset Lokomotiv in the Russian Super Cup match and scored six goals in nine RPL starting rounds.

The captain also scored a brace for the Russian national team in the League of Nations match with Serbia.

However, then the footballer had a scoring drought, which has lasted for 521 minutes, not counting the stoppage time.

Heavy loads and age

At the same time, we must not forget that October turned out to be an incredibly difficult month for the striker, because in 22 days he was forced to play seven games in all tournaments.

That is, Dziuba, who turned 32 in August, had to go out on the field every three days on average.

This is a very big load for an older athlete, especially with his anthropometry.

It only complicated Artyom's life and the unusual calendar of the Russian national team, which held three meetings in just six days.

If the participation of the captain in the matches of the League of Nations with Turkey and Hungary did not raise any questions, then entering the field in a friendly game with Sweden even surprised at half-time.

Stanislav Cherchesov could have given the leading footballer a little respite, and provided practice to Nikolai Komlichenko with Alexander Sobolev, but he still released the veteran onto the field.

In the next two official matches, Dziuba invariably did not have enough strength for the ending, but Cherchesov did not dare to change him in this situation either.

Upon his return from the national team in Zenit, the captain was still given a little rest, and he remained in reserve for the meeting of the 11th round of the RPL with Sochi (3: 1).

Nevertheless, in the 66th minute, he was nevertheless thrown into battle immediately after the southerners reduced the gap in the long run to a minimum.

But even such a break helped the footballer play a good Champions League match with Club Brugge a few days later.

Having failed the first half, like the whole team, after the break, Artyom looked much better: he actively clung to the balls and competently played along with his partners.

And when the score was 1: 1, he almost hit the opponent's goal with a blow at close range.

At the moment, Dziuba has become a hostage of his own importance both for the club and for the national team, because without him it is impossible to imagine both teams.

For Cherchesov, Artyom is not only the captain and the main forward, but also the footballer around whom the whole team's offensive game is built in the absence of injured Alexander Golovin and Alexei Miranchuk.

After the World Cup, the forward missed only two matches of the national squad, both of which were friendly and due to injuries (with the Czech Republic and Germany in 2018).

For example, at the decisive meeting of the League of Nations last season in November 2018 with Sweden, he entered the field with an incompletely healed injury and played all 90 minutes.

And since November 2018, the striker has not missed a single game of the national team at all, spent at least half on the field (with Sweden).

If Artyom was changed, then only at the end of the meetings.

At the same time, the football player does not get younger, and it is obvious that it is more and more difficult for him to withstand such a load.

It's also hard to imagine the current Zenit without Dziuba.

Artyom has a well-played duet with Serdar Azmun, and it is very difficult to replace the Russian in this pair with anyone.

So, in the last season of the RPL, both scored 17 goals and shared the title of the league's top scorer.

And Artyom with 12 assists, in addition, became the best assistant of the tournament.

In addition, the captain of the Petersburgers was recognized as the best player of the RPL-2019/20 season according to the results of a vote by coaches and team captains, as well as journalists.

Towards a conflict with Semak

Dziuba's indispensability for the national team can be understood, since there are still no such effective and useful strikers in the country.

But "Zenith", which has serious financial resources, could well, if not find a replacement for the captain, then at least strengthen the attack.

However, the club strengthened all lines in the summer, except for the attack.

Thus, at least until winter, Sergei Semak will have to rely solely on Dzyuba and Azmun, and the loss of one of them will turn into serious problems for the team.

The absence of the Iranian in the game against Rubin led to the defeat.

At the same time, it is not entirely clear how the aged captain would react to the young coach's decision to keep him in reserve.

The footballer plays a significant role in the success of the team, which is almost higher than the role of Semak, and this move would hardly have caused him positive emotions.

For example, in the match with Spartak the specialist wanted to change Dziuba in the end, but he reacted to this extremely emotionally and as a result remained on the field.

After the final whistle, Semak called the incident a "game moment", but it is possible that he himself does not want to go into conflict with the leading football player, given the history of the latter's relationship with other specialists.

One way or another, the striker has nowhere to draw strength in the near future, since until December 16, Zenit are waiting for five matches of the group stage of the Champions League and seven for the RPL.

The national team will again have three meetings in six days in November.

And more and more tired Dzyuba risks repeating his "achievement" two years ago, when he did not score at the club level from October 25 to April 20 - almost six months.
